This is a re-edit I did of the 1712 flashback in the Highlander: Endgame film. Its a combination of the scene as edited in the Theatrical/Producers Cuts and the Rough Cut, with the addition of the date change from 1712 to 1747. As I explain in the description of this video, the reason for the date change, is simple: Originally, it was gonna be set there. At least, according to Adrian Paul, who at a convention in 1999, mentioned that there was to be a reference to Culloden in the film. Since this flashback makes mention of the British having destroyed the clans, it only makes sense that this was the placement he was thinking, since the British DID destroy the clans after the Culloden fight. 1712 the clans were merely disbanded, and Duncans tone indicates a more personal pain in his caring. This is Duncan whos not gonna go back to Scotland for another 250 years. But, like Connor says in the flashback, he will go back one day, and indeed he did.
